The Duty of Court Reporters in the Legal System



Stenotype reporter play an important function in the lawful system by providing impartial and accurate transcripts of procedures. Their work warranties that courtroom discussions, witness testimonies, and legal disagreements are consistently recorded, acting as a main record for future recommendation. This documentation is essential for appeals, lawful research study, and preserving the stability of judicial procedures. Court reporters are educated specialists experienced in stenography and numerous taping technologies, enabling them to record talked words with precision. They need to possess a thorough understanding of legal terminology and court room methods, assuring that their records fulfill the standards needed by the judicial system. Furthermore, they might supply real-time transcription solutions, enabling judges and attorneys to accessibility information immediately during procedures. By meeting these responsibilities, stenotype reporter assist in transparency, accountability, and the reasonable management of justice, thus strengthening the foundational concepts of the legal system.


Guaranteeing Accuracy in Transcription



Precision in transcription is critical for keeping the honesty of lawful procedures. Stenotype reporter meticulously record every word spoken during depositions, hearings, and tests, ensuring that the official record reflects real discussion and exchanges that occur. This precision is essential, as also minor errors can lead to significant misunderstandings or false impressions of the law.


To accomplish this degree of precision, court press reporters employ various techniques, including active listening and making use of specialized shorthand approaches. Continuous training and knowledge with legal terminology also improve their ability to produce trustworthy records.




The verification procedure is essential; reporters often evaluate their records for possible inconsistencies prior to last entry. This persistance not just supports the quality of legal documents however also supports the judicial process, allowing lawyers and courts to reference accurate records when making choices. Ultimately, accurate transcription promotes rely on the lawful system and assurances that justice is served.
